To report five cases of gonococcal keratoconjunctivitis with severe corneal involvement treated with therapeutic keratoplasty.
Retrospective case series.
Five consecutive cases of gonococcal ...keratoconjunctivitis treated with keratoplasty for corneal perforation, with a mean age of 21.2 years, were analysed by patient's history, surgical approaches, and clinical outcomes, corrected visual acuity at initial visit and last follow-up.
All adult cases were originally diagnosed as epidemic keratoconjunctivitis by elsewhere, and corneal perforation occurred with a mean duration of 11 days after development of conjunctivitis. While laboratory tests revealed Neisseria gonorrhoeae in all five cases, three patients showed resistance to ofloxacin. Intensive medical treatment using penicillins and/or cephems was initiated. Two patients had peripheral corneal perforations, one had a paracentral perforation, and another, a large corneal perforation with stromal melting. One case had a central microcorneal perforation. In all cases, the anterior chamber was flat. Corneal perforations were treated with lamellar or penetrating keratoplasty using cryopreserved or fresh corneal grafts. All grafts remained clear during the mean follow-up period of 34.9 months. Final best-corrected visual acuity ranged from 20/60 to 20/16.
Severe gonococcal keratoconjunctivitis can benefit from intensive surgical and medical intervention resulting in satisfactory visual rehabilitation.

The present study was performed to elucidate whether the estrogen binding component regarded as a receptor exists in the plasma membrane fraction of neurohypophysis in hens and whether the binding of ...receptor changes with relation to oviposition. The specific binding for estradiol-17β (E₂) in the neurohypophysis of hens was demonstrated by the use of radioligand binding assays on the plasma membrane fraction of the tissue. The binding to ³HE₂ had a binding specificity to E₂ and diethylstilbestrol, reversibility, and saturation. Scatchard analysis revealed that the binding sites are of a single class. The equilibrium dissociation constant obtained by Scatchard analysis and kinetic analysis suggested a high affinity, and the maximum binding capacity obtained by Scatchard analysis suggested a limited capacity. These properties are characteristics of a receptor, which suggests that an estrogen receptor exists in the plasma membrane of hen neurohypophysis. The equilibrium dissociation constant value of estrogen receptor of the neurohypophysis was not significantly different between laying hens and nonlaying hens, but the maximum binding capacity value was statistically smaller (the binding affinity is higher) in laying hens than in nonlaying hens. The specific binding of estrogen receptor showed a decrease at 1 h after an injection of diethylstilbestrol in nonlaying hens. The specific binding also decreased 3 h before oviposition in laying hens and maintained low value until just after oviposition. The present study suggests that estrogen may act directly on the neurohypophysis during 3 h before oviposition in hens.
Maintenance hemodialysis outpatients must limit salt and water intake to maintain electrolyte balance and blood pressure. In Kawashima Hospital, nationally registered dietitians provide hemodialysis ...patients with monthly nutritional counseling. We investigated whether nutritional counseling affects interdialytic weight gain (IDWG) and blood pressure. We investigated 48 hemodialysis patients whose monthly average IDWG ratio to dry weight exceeded 5.1% and who had not had a long-term hospital admittance of > 1 month. After the 48-month nutritional counseling period, the IDWG ratio had improved in 37 of the patients (77.1%), significantly decreasing from 6.0±0.7 to 5.3±0.9%. Estimated salt and water intake decreased significantly from 13.3±2.7 to 11.8±2.4 g/day and 2528±455 to 2332±410 ml/day, respectively. During the intervention period, normalized protein catabolic rate and body mass index did not change substantially. Pre-hemodialysis systolic and diastolic blood pressures had significantly decreased from 149±19 to 134±18 mmHg, and 82±13 to 75±10 mmHg for 48 months after study initiation, respectively. The dosage of antihypertensive drugs had significantly decreased in the group that experienced improvement in the IDWG ratio. Long-term nutritional counseling by nationally registered dietitians may improve the IDWG ratio and blood pressure of hemodialysis patients by decreasing their salt and water intake. J. Med. Butterhead lettuce, rucola, watercress, kale, chicory, cabbage, Chinese cabbage, and a spinach substitute (
Tetragonia expansa) are widely consumed in Southern Brazil. Samples were collected five ...times during a year in food markets and analyzed for total potassium, sodium, calcium, magnesium, iron, manganese, copper, and zinc by flame atomic absorption spectrometry and for moisture content. All vegetables can contribute to diet in terms of potassium, calcium and magnesium. Kale offers the highest amounts of calcium (283±43
mg Ca/100
g) and Chinese cabbage, cabbage, and butterhead lettuce the lowest, with values from 33 to 58
mg Ca/100
g. The highest concentrations of magnesium were found in kale and in the spinach substitute and they were 52±4 and 55±16
mg Ca/100
g, respectively. Moisture content varied less among samples of the same vegetable than minerals did. Four of the vegetables (kale, chicory, Chinese cabbage, and cabbage) were cooked briefly during 3
min and analyzed for the same elements. The brief cooking did not cause appreciable losses for any of the minerals.
To elucidate whether the receptor for prostaglandin (PG) F₂α, one of PG, exists in the neurohypophysis in hens and whether the binding of receptor changes with relation to oviposition, the PGF₂α ...binding component in the membrane fraction of the neurohypophysis of laying hens was analyzed by radioligand binding assay using 5,6,8,9,11,12,14,15(n)-³HPGF₂α. The binding component had characteristics of a receptor such as binding specificity, high affinity, and limited capacity for PGF₂α. Scatchard analysis indicated that the binding site was of a single class. The binding capacity of the receptor was smaller in laying hens than in nonlaying hens, whereas the binding affinity was not significantly different between these hens. When non-laying hens received an i.m. injection of estradiol-17β or progesterone (0.5 mg/hen), the specific binding of the PGF₂α receptor in the neurohypophysis was decreased. In laying hens, the specific binding decreased and the blood arginine vasotocin (AVT) concentration increased just after oviposition but did not change during a 24-h day in nonlaying hens. An i.v. injection of PGF₂α (2 μg/hen) induced oviposition and caused an increase in the blood AVT concentration with a decrease in the specific binding of PGF₂α receptor. The present study suggests a possibility that PGF₂α may directly cause the AVT release from the neurohypophysis at oviposition time in hens.

The present study was performed to elucidate whether the receptor for calcitonin (CT) exists in the adrenocortical cells of hens and to determine the effect of CT on adrenocorticotropic hormone ...(ACTH)-stimulated corticosterone production in its cell. The binding site of CT in the membrane fraction of the adrenal gland in hens was determined using a ¹²⁵ICT binding assay system. The binding properties in the adrenal gland satisfied the criteria of a receptor-ligand interaction in terms of specificity, reversibility, and saturation. When the cortical cells were incubated in vitro with chicken ACTH in the presence of CT, greater corticosterone production was observed. The result suggested that CT acts directly on the adrenocortical cells via its receptor binding and increases responsiveness of ACTH on corticosterone production in the laying hen.
